WebFluorescence in situ hybridization (FISH) allows visualization of specific DNA sequences and can therefore be used for quantitation of chromosomes and genes, including aneusomy, chromosomal deletions, amplifications, and translocations in interphase nuclei. WebFluorescence in situ hybridization (FISH) is a molecular cytogenetic technique that uses fluorescent probes that bind to only particular parts of a nucleic acid sequence with a high degree of sequence complementarity.It was developed by biomedical researchers in the early 1980s to detect and localize the presence or absence of specific DNA sequences …
WebDec 20, 2012 · Chromosome enumeration in interphase and metaphase cells using fluorescence in situ hybridization (FISH) is an established procedure for the rapid and accurate cytogenetic analysis of cell nuclei and polar bodies, the unambiguous gender determination, as well as the definition of tumor-specific signatures.
